Light Airs Upwind
Launch in external player

Key points:

  • Trim the bow down so the transom doesn’t dig in
  • Keep the sails twisted for speed and acceleration
  • Helm goes high on the wire to make movement easier to balance the boat flat


Trim the boat bow down. Try to keep the transom out of the water so that drag is reduced. The boat should be steered accurately and smoothly to the jib tell tales. Try to maintain speed by keeping the sails well twisted.

Helm

If you need to trapeze then pull your trapeze adjusters up high. This makes it a lot easier to move smoothly in and out. Try to keep the boat as flat as possible by using your body weight.

You should either be sat or trapezing right up by the shroud to lift the transom. Only move back from here to stop waves coming over the bow.

Crew

Sit in the bow facing backwards. Be careful not to sit on the jib sheets or distort the jib. Keep low so as to reduce windage and don’t obstruct the air flow through the jib slot. This can be an uncomfortable position after a while!
